In India, most comprehensive health insurance plans in 2026 cover **day care procedures**. These are medical treatments or surgeries that require hospitalization for **less than 24 hours** because of advances in medical technology. They are an exception to the traditional 24-hour hospitalization rule. Common day care procedures covered include: - Cataract surgery - Chemotherapy and radiotherapy - Dialysis - Coronary angiography - Lithotripsy (kidney stone treatment) - Minor ENT surgeries - Eye surgeries - Certain orthopedic procedures - Skin grafts and plastic surgery for medical reasons ### How many procedures are covered? Coverage varies by insurer: - Many plans cover **140 to 600+** listed day care procedures. - Some comprehensive policies cover **all medically necessary day care procedures**, rather than a fixed list. ### Popular Indian plans with day care coverage Examples of plans that include extensive day care benefits are: - HDFC ERGO Optima Secure - Care Supreme - Niva Bupa ReAssure 2.0 - Aditya Birla Activ One MAX - ManipalCigna ProHealth - Star Health Comprehensive - ICICI Lombard Elevate (benefits vary by variant) ### What is usually required for a claim? Most insurers require: - The procedure to be medically necessary. - Treatment at a registered hospital or approved day care centre. - Admission as an inpatient, even if only for a few hours. - The procedure to be covered under the policy terms. ### Choosing a plan in 2026 When comparing policies, look for: - Coverage for **all day care procedures** instead of a limited list. - Cashless treatment at a large network of hospitals. - No disease-specific restrictions on common procedures. - Adequate sum insured (₹10–25 lakh is a common recommendation for many families, depending on healthcare needs and budget). In India, **day care procedures** refer to surgical or medical treatments that traditionally required an overnight stay but can now be completed in **less than 24 hours** due to advancements in medical technology. Under the IRDAI regulations, standard and comprehensive health insurance policies cover these procedures, but how they are covered varies significantly depending on your specific policy. --- ## 📋 Common Day Care Procedures Covered Most comprehensive plans in India cover anywhere between **140 to over 540+ day care procedures**. They generally span across major medical categories: * **Ophthalmology:** Cataract surgery, vitrectomy, glaucoma surgery. * **Oncology:** Chemotherapy, radiotherapy, immunotherapy. * **Urology & Nephrology:** Dialysis, lithotripsy (kidney stone removal), hydrocele surgery. * **ENT:** Tonsillectomy, septoplasty, tympanoplasty (eardrum repair). * **Gastroenterology:** Laparoscopic appendectomy, gallstone removal (cholecystectomy), piles/fistula surgeries. * **Orthopedics:** Arthroscopic surgery (knee/shoulder), ligament tear repair, minor fracture reductions. --- ## 🚫 Day Care vs. OPD: What is EXCLUDED? A very common point of confusion is mistaking **OPD (Outpatient Department)** consultations for day care procedures. If a treatment does not require formal admission into a short-stay bed/day care unit or the use of an Operation Theatre (OT)/specialized equipment, it is likely considered an OPD expense and **will not be covered** under standard day care benefits. **Typically Excluded from Day Care Coverage:** * Routine doctor consultations, vaccinations, and health check-ups. * Outpatient diagnostic tests (like standard blood tests, X-rays, or MRIs) unless they are explicitly part of the pre-hospitalization routine for a scheduled surgery. * Minor clinic procedures (dressing minor wounds, stitching small cuts, ear wax removal). * Dental treatments and cosmetic procedures (like LASIK or chemical peels), unless required due to an accident. --- ## 🔍 Key Factors to Check Before Buying/Claiming When comparing health insurance plans for day care coverage, look closely at these parameters: ### 1. "All Day Care" vs. "Listed Day Care" * **Budget/Basic Plans (e.g., Arogya Sanjeevani):** Often cover a strict, specific list of named procedures (e.g., 140 or 200 treatments). If your procedure isn't on that exact list, it won't be covered. * **Comprehensive Plans:** Many top insurers now promise **"All Day Care Procedures Covered,"** meaning if medical tech reduces *any* surgical process to under 24 hours, it's eligible. ### 2. Sub-limits and Capping Even if a procedure is covered, insurers frequently place a **cap (sub-limit)** on specific surgeries. For instance, a policy with a ₹10 Lakh sum insured might limit cataract surgery payouts to ₹40,000 per eye. ### 3. Waiting Periods * **Initial Period:** A standard 30-day waiting period applies to all non-accidental day care procedures from the policy start date. * **Specific Diseases:** Planned procedures like cataracts, hernia, or joint replacements often have a **1 to 2-year specific waiting period**. * **Pre-existing Diseases (PED):** If the day care procedure relates to a condition you had prior to buying the policy, a waiting period of up to 3 years applies (mandated by IRDAI). --- ## 🛒 Prominent Plans Known for Comprehensive Day Care Coverage Several insurers offer extensive day care benefits where expenses are covered up to the total Sum Insured without restrictive list counts: | Insurance Plan | Day Care Coverage Approach | |:--- |:--- | | **HDFC ERGO Optima Secure** | Covers all day care procedures up to the sum insured. | | **Niva Bupa ReAssure 3.0** | Comprehensive day care coverage with unlimited restoration features. | | **Care Health (Care Supreme)** | Extensive coverage covering a massive catalog of tech-driven modern treatments. | | **Tata AIG MediCare Premier** | Covers 540+ day care procedures, including global coverage options if diagnosed in India. | --- ## 💡 How to Claim 1. **Cashless (Recommended):** Choose a network hospital. Submit a pre-authorization form via the hospital's TPA desk **24–48 hours before** the scheduled day care procedure. The insurer will approve and clear the eligible bills directly. 2. **Reimbursement:** If using a non-network hospital, pay upfront. Collect the **discharge summary, original bills, prescriptions, and diagnostic reports**, then submit them to the insurer within 15–30 days of discharge.

As of mid-2026, health insurance plans in India increasingly prioritize comprehensive coverage, with most reputable insurers covering **day care procedures** —treatments requiring less than 24 hours of hospitalization due to advanced technology. Here are key aspects and top plans covering day care procedures in 2026: **Top Health Insurance Plans with Day Care Coverage** - **Aditya Birla Activ One Plan:** Covers all day care procedures. - **HDFC ERGO Optima Secure Plan:** Covers all day care procedures. - **Royal Sundaram Lifeline Insurance Plan:** Covers all day care procedures. - **SBI General Health Edge Insurance Plan:** Covers all day care procedures. - **ManipalCigna ProHealth Insurance Plan:** Covers 546+ day care procedures, including oncology, dialysis, and ENT. - **Care Health Insurance Plan:** Covers 541+ day care procedures. - **Magma HDI OneHealth Insurance Plan:** Covers 541+ day care procedures. **Commonly Covered Day Care Procedures** - **Ophthalmology:** Cataract surgery, corneal transplants, and glaucoma surgeries. - **Oncology:** Chemotherapy, radiotherapy, and immunotherapy sessions. - **Nephrology:** Dialysis and renal biopsies. - **ENT (Ear, Nose, Throat):** Tonsillectomy, septoplasty, and tympanoplasty. **Key Considerations for 2026** - **Comprehensive Coverage:** Look for plans covering "all" day care procedures rather than a limited list to ensure maximum protection. - **Coverage Amounts:** In 2026, experts recommend a minimum sum insured of ₹15 lakhs for individuals and ₹20-25 lakhs for family floaters, especially to cover modern, expensive treatments. - **Restoration Benefits:** Opt for policies that restore the sum insured if it is used up during the policy year, ensuring coverage for future day care treatments. - **No Room Rent Limits:** Choose policies without room rent capping to avoid significant out-of-pocket expenses. When choosing a policy, ensure you review the specific policy document to understand the exact, updated list of covered procedures for 2026.
